Transaction 214c62d65bc4971fa39fed123d1da16791660e8fc40277d533fac445a01f66c6
1 Input
1 Output
-
214c62d65bc4971fa39fed123d1da16791660e8fc40277d533fac445a01f66c6:0
- value
- 495574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ec1784b74433e3fc64b5f9737f90799c0054fcf OP_EQUAL
- address
- 38sSQ2kKRGek4atuBJ321Kgp2obmpEGPRt